They have two real trains and one model train set up. But they have much more then just trains. They have a great exhibit on how they used to make glassware as in plates and they explain how pharmacies used to make pop. It's pretty cool and if there's some places that are interactive as well. Also have a play area inside build like a train. They have a section on the history on mining.

Interactive exhibits include model water wheels (turbans) and steam engines (operated with compressed air).

The artifacts are unique and include train locomotives, ingots, automobiles, and a pump house.

A tasteful and sobering exhibit on the dangers if mining reminds us of the need for safety, training, and technology.
